
There are a number of options for cleaning HRSG’s which include high pressure water jetting, grit blasting, CO² blasting and Tube Tech’s innovative new safeblasTT™ system. Heat recovery steam generators (HRSG’s) are heat exchangers that recover heat from a hot gas system. They produce steam that can then be used in a process or used to drive a steam turbine. HRSG’s are found in combined-cycle power stations and in cogeneration plants which typically have a higher overall efficiency compared to combined-cycle plants.
In the energy-rich Persian Gulf region, the steam from the HRSG is used for desalination plants.
Although HRSG’s are most often part of a relatively clean burning natural gas environment they still need to be cleaned. Cleaned fins improve thermal performance and reduce the corrosion caused by deposits.
